Okay here is this thing i noticed of the mentality of Pakistani people. Mainly concerning their government.

Before they were very dictatorship and professed their support to democracy but after Musharraf was removed from power and the chaos that came in afterwards. Well lets just say people somehow now support him more than before.

They now agree with him on his siege on a mosqur called Lal Masjid( Red Mosque).  Where he cracked down on a group of extremist muslims in the country. Villified for it before they now support his action and also i have noticed there has been a push to instead of negotiate but to have the army step the war up in the NW. A push for crackdowns on mosques around the country which before would have been considered heretical.
